Extreme Heat Poses Significant Challenges to Global Supply Chains
Logistics Business Magazine, in its recent publication on July 24, 2025, at 12:29, highlighted a growing concern for businesses worldwide: the increasing impact of extreme heat on the stability and efficiency of supply chains. The article, titled “Extreme Heat Puts Supply Chains Under Pressure,” sheds light on the multifaceted challenges presented by rising global temperatures and their direct implications for the movement of goods and services.
The report details how prolonged periods of intense heat are no longer isolated incidents but are becoming a recurring feature of the global climate. This shift is placing unprecedented strain on various aspects of the logistics sector, from transportation infrastructure to warehouse operations and the integrity of the goods themselves.
One of the primary concerns discussed is the impact on transportation. Road networks can be affected by buckling asphalt, while rail lines may experience distortions, leading to slower speeds and potential delays. Aviation can also be impacted, with higher temperatures affecting aircraft performance and potentially grounding flights during peak heat. Furthermore, the transportation of temperature-sensitive goods, such as pharmaceuticals and fresh produce, becomes significantly more challenging and costly to maintain the required cold chain integrity.
Warehousing and storage facilities are also feeling the pressure. Maintaining optimal temperature and humidity levels within warehouses becomes a more energy-intensive and expensive undertaking. This can lead to increased operational costs and, in extreme cases, compromise the quality and safety of stored products. The article suggests that businesses are increasingly re-evaluating their storage strategies and investing in more robust climate control systems.
The article also touches upon the human element. Warehouse workers and drivers operating in extreme heat conditions face increased health risks. Implementing adequate safety protocols, providing sufficient hydration, and adjusting work schedules are crucial considerations for employers to ensure the well-being of their workforce, which in turn can affect operational capacity.
Looking ahead, “Extreme Heat Puts Supply Chains Under Pressure” emphasizes the need for proactive adaptation and resilience. The logistics industry is being urged to consider innovative solutions such as developing more heat-resistant infrastructure, optimizing routing to avoid the hottest regions during peak times, and exploring alternative transportation methods. Investing in advanced monitoring technologies to track temperature fluctuations throughout the supply chain is also becoming increasingly vital.
